Olympia, WA – On Saturday, a one man was shot during a “Back the Blue” and “Stop the Steal” protest that turned violent at Washington’s Capitol when counter protestors (Antifa) showed up to the scene.
It’s been reported that over 100 officers arrived at the Capitol when the initial squabbles took place. During the initial confrontation between the groups, police made an arrest for an alleged weapons violation near Ninth Avenue and Columbia Street. It’s been reported that that person arrested was a Proud Boy who pointed a gun at a counter protestor.

Evanston, Illinois – What started as a peaceful protest on Saturday, quickly turned for the worst in Evanston, Illinois’ Northwestern University campus.
A demonstration by approximately 150 students that demanded the university abolish its police department quickly descended into chaos resulting in property damage, protestors throwing bricks at police and shining high powered lasers into police officers eyes.
The protestors also launched fireworks at officers during the rioting that eventuated Saturday night, resulting in the arrest of one protestor and the pepper spraying of two others as Police moved to control and disperse the crowd.
